Located in the West Linn-Wilsonville School District 3j at 4515 South Cedaroak Dr in West Linn, OR, Cedaroak Park Primary School serves grades PK-5 and has an enrollment of roughly 413 students. Frequently Asked Questions about West Linn
What is the current price range for One Bedroom West Linn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in West Linn ranges from $1,370 to $3,390 with an average monthly rent of $1,857.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in West Linn c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in West Linn range from $1,350 to $7,835.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,071.
How expensive are West Linn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 61 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in West Linn on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,749 to $6,110 - averaging $2,637 for the location.
